22

Visual Studio 2012 をインストールしたばかりで、MVC 4 と Web Api のチェックアウトを開始しました。Web API を使用して新しい MVC 4 アプリを作成しました。いくつかの例とチュートリアルに基づいて、ルートの構成を開始しました。

routes.MapHttpRoute(
                name: "Controller only",
                routeTemplate: "api/{controller}"
            );

RouteCollectionただし、の定義が含まれていないというエラーが発生しますMapHttpRoute。いくつかの DLL がインストールされていませんか? 私が見る限り、適切な DLL とバージョンがすべてインストールされています。

4

3 に答える 3

33

System.Web.HttpRouteConfig.csに参照を追加して解決しました

于 2012-09-17T10:53:02.480 に答える
5

使用して追加するだけSystem.Web.Mvc;で問題が解決しました

于 2013-11-10T11:20:02.733 に答える